Backman, Sharon Maureen, 1932-2012
Dates
- Existence: 1932 - 2012
Biographical History
Sharon Maureen Backman (1932-2012) was a missionary for the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ints in England, Utah, Illinois, and Ohio.

Found in 2 Collections and/or Records:
Milton V. and Sharon Maureen Backman personal papers, 1943-2013
Contains correspondence, journals, photographs, and other personal items of Milton Vaughn Backman and Sharon Richey Backman. Includes documents pertaining to the various trips the Bachman family made (including to locations like Aruba and Church history sites like Nauvoo, Illinois), family records including birth/death certificates, a list of callings Sharon Richey Backman had, and audio-visual materials including photographs, CDs, and VHS cassettes. Dated 1943-2013.
Sharon Maureen Backman personal papers, approximately 1980-2013
Contains photographs, correspondence, and other personal memorabilia of Sharon Richey Backman. Materials include copies of the Backman family's Book of Remembrance, memorial service documentation, details on the Backmans' children and foster children, a list of callings she held, and photographs from her time serving in Nauvoo, Illinois. Dated approximately 1980-2013.
